[Invited Talk] The New Trend of Dye-Sensitized Solar Cells
Satoshi Uchida, Hiroshi Segawa (RCAST, Univ. Tokyo), Seigo Ito (Univ. Hyogo) ED2007-260
Abstract (in Japanese) (See Japanese page) 
(in English) tized nanocrystalline titanium dioxide (DSSC) has been developed by M. Grätzel et al. Remarkably high quantum efficiency in combination with the expected ease and low cost of manufacturing makes this new technology interesting as an alternative to existent solar cell technologies. Various elemental technologies of dye-sensitized solar cells have therefore been researched, including the sensitized dye, semiconductor particles, electrolyte, electron transfer process and photovoltaic mechanism.
In spite of these vigorous studies, the assembling of flexible TiO2/dye solar cell is still under investigation. Flexible electrodes, like polyethylene terephthalate sheet coated with tin-doped indium oxide (PET-ITO), present lower costs and technological advantages relative to conductive glass electrodes, e.g. lower weight, impact resistance and less form and shape limitations. Here in this work, microwave irradiation process is newly proposed for selective heating the nanocrystalline titanium oxide films of DSSC.
